Introduction The Department is in the process of seeking a Consultant to provide Facility Management Services for facilities such as the Miami Intermodal Center (MIC) Miami Central Station (MCS) and Right of Way Services on the Department s other projects within Miami-Dade and Monroe Counties. The Miami Intermodal Center (MIC) Program components include the Right of Way Program completed in 2003, the Roadway Improvement Program completed in 2008, the Rental Car Center (RCC) operated by Miami Dade Aviation Department since 2010 and providing rental car facilities for Miami International Airport (MIA), MIA Mover completed in 2011 and the Miami Central Station which is currently under construction. Miami Central Station (MCS) provides structures for Metrorail, Metrobus, TriRail, Amtrak, Intercity bus, and other operators together with roads and associated parking. All providing connectivity to the RCC. Miami Central Station (MCS) is linked to the RCC with an overhead pedestrian bridge referred to as Concourse East and West. The Concourse is connected to all the train and other facilities. The MCS complex covers approximately 27 acres with elevators, escalators, canopies, a bus terminal, taxi rank, set-down & pick up areas and its own roadway system. Services to be Provided by Consultant Facility Operations and Management: The management, operation and maintenance of transportation facilities owned by the Department, such as an intermodal hub/center, truck stop, train station or facilities at or near seaports, airports or any general transportation interchange complex. The Consultant will be required to submit a Business Plan (including staffing, operating and maintenance estimates) for the MIC Miami Central Station facility to be managed. All in accordance with good building management practices as recommended by the Building Owners and Managers Institute (BOMI) or Real Estate Institute (REI) or similar professional bodies. Miami Central Station facility management: The Consultant shall provide staffing to transition the Miami Central Station facility from construction completion stage to open for operation, thereafter manage, operate and provide maintenance services for Miami Central Station on a 24 hour basis. The Business Plan should cover the day to day staffing, management, security, monitoring of fire and other systems, janitorial services, control and maintenance of parking lots and common areas, maintenance of mechanical and electrical systems, and general upkeep of the facilities to ensure they are secure, safe, clean, sanitary and fully functional for public use. The Consultant will be responsible for the complete operation and maintenance of facilities covering ITN-DOT-14/ HO Exhibit A Scope of Services Page 3 of 7

4 such items as, but not limited to: (a) Exterior and interior lighting (b) Electrical systems, equipment and associated fixtures & fittings (c) Plumbing systems and associated fixtures and fittings (d) HVAC systems, escalators, elevators, generators, pumps, etc. (e) General repair, including painting and upkeep of all interior/exterior walls ceilings, signs (f) Fire protection and safety equipment, Public Address systems (g) Interior (plants, etc.,) and exterior landscaping (h) Audit review and processing of all bills for utilities and services. (i) Repair and maintenance of utilities and services to the facility (j) Interior and exterior cleaning and janitorial supplies (k) Collection and removal of garbage, waste and debris from site (l) Maintain control of and manage all parking lots, sidewalks and Roadways. Set and collect parking fees. (m) Maintain and operate a customer service office with staffing and associated office equipment, telecommunications and supplies related to the facility. (n) Provide security or other staff to maintain the facilities 24/7 as needed. (o) Provide all equipment and supplies as needed to operate facilities. (p) Develop and maintain a Preventative Maintenance program for the facility covering such items as, but not limited to, roof inspections, roof drains, canopies, exterior walls and glazing maintenance, glass cleaning, external, lighting, roadway sweeping/cleaning, repair, road markings, sign repair and replacement, storm and sewer drains, air conditioning, electrical and mechanical equipment systems, other systems. (q) Emergency evacuations instructions, procedures and building preparation for hurricanes or other events. (r) (s) (t) Draft the rules and regulations for use of the facility for Department approval. Enforce rules and regulations Prepare operational and maintenance costs charges for apportionment to users Recommend Permit process, fees and collection methods for regular and ad hoc users of pick-up/drop-off areas. (u) Provide miscellaneous services that may be required to keep The facilities operational and safe for public use.
